Director-Network Services

AT&THouston, TX
Onsite

About The Position

As Director-Network Services, you will lead large, multi-disciplinary teams responsible for the end-to-end performance of complex network infrastructure. You will translate enterprise strategy into operational execution, ensure regulatory and environmental compliance, and drive reliability, efficiency, and service excellence across markets. Your leadership will directly impact customer experience, operational continuity, and long-term network evolution.

Requirements

  • Experience leading large-scale network operations across wireless, wireline, voice, video, and data services
  • Proven ability to oversee complex network deployment, maintenance, and operational support environments
  • Strong background in regulatory, compliance, and performance management within network services
  • Ability to manage budgets, operational costs, and workforce productivity
  • Hands-on experience resolving high-severity outages and infrastructure escalations
  • Bachelor’s degree (BS/BA) preferred
  • 10+ years of related experience in network services, infrastructure operations, or telecommunications
  • Demonstrated success leading large organizations, including managing managers and career-level professionals
  • Experience influencing hiring, promotion, disciplinary, and compensation decisions

Responsibilities

  • Lead, develop, and coach managers, engineers, and technicians through structured performance management, training, and engagement rhythms
  • Oversee planning, deployment, maintenance, and daily operations of wireless, wireline, VOIP, video, and data network services
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, industry standards, and regulatory requirements while supporting environmental obligations tied to network operations
  • Monitor network performance metrics, manage budgets, improve productivity, and report operational risks and outcomes to senior leadership
  • Identify and mitigate operational risks, manage escalations for high-severity network incidents, and resolve complex service-impacting issues
  • Collaborate with cross-functional partners to execute market-level service activation plans and contribute to regional and national initiatives
